Q: Is 30,055,252 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 30,055,252 is a composite number.

Why is 30,055,252 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 30,055,252 can be evenly divided by 1 2 4 17 29 34 58 68 116 493 986 1,972 15,241 30,482 60,964 259,097 441,989 518,194 883,978 1,036,388 1,767,956 7,513,813 15,027,626 and 30,055,252, with no remainder.

Since 30,055,252 cannot be divided by just 1 and 30,055,252, it is a composite number.
